Source: ‘Dexter’ Stars Michael C. Hall & Jennifer Carpenter Separating
HOLLYWOOD, Calif. --

“Dexter” co-stars Michael C. Hall and Jennifer Carpenter are allegedly separating, Access Hollywood has learned exclusively.

A source tells Access that, according to a person very close to the production, the real life husband and wife, who play brother and sister Dexter & Deborah Morgan on the hit Showtime show, haven’t been getting along on set all season and that it’s widely known an official separation announcement is imminent.

In fact, Access’ source was told that Carpenter was going around the set talking about the couple’s problems during the course of the show’s production.

Additionally, our source was informed that Hall, Carpenter and the rest of the show’s cast are very worried about how the two of them are going to work as closely together on set next season as they’re usually required to do.

“Dexter” held its fifth season finale party in New York Sunday night –Carpenter was present, but Hall was not.

“Dexter’s” fifth season finale Sunday night attracted 2.9 million viewers, making it the series’ highest rated season yet. The show has averaged over 5 million viewers per week, across linear and on demand viewing. The show has already been picked up for a sixth season.

Hall and Carpenter married on December 31, 2008. Hall was previously married to Broadway actress Amy Spangler from 2002 to 2006.

Showtime had no comment on this report. Access has reached out to reps for Hall and Carpenter, but has not received comment back at this time.
